Output c3c811e62c6bb493b8cf4bd9860e339352379f986836a5cf67da4c4efc51aad1:11

value
12674844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deac18ab7195a546fad5d2e51b7306f14eb79a0b OP_EQUAL
address
MUCYQUtdP6azqug299Ds2AaUTKTeNQSHwT
transaction
c3c811e62c6bb493b8cf4bd9860e339352379f986836a5cf67da4c4efc51aad1
spent
true